According to ChatGPT

Instant Ocean:
Matches typical seawater levels
Calcium ~400 ppm
Magnesium ~1320 ppm (close to natural ocean)

Reef Crystals:
Higher calcium and magnesium than standard Instant Ocean
Intended to better support corals and invertebrates without as much supplementation

In hobbyist tests and charts, Reef Crystals often shows:
Calcium nearer 490 ppm
Magnesium near 1440 ppm
Higher alkalinity
